gary
PostPosted: Tue Feb 20, 2007 4:56 pm    Post subject:

change c14, c14a (2200mfd 10v) c18 c19 (1000mfd 16v)in the psu, if that does not restore operation replace all other capacitors in psu.

PostPosted: Tue Feb 20, 2007 4:35 pm    Post subject: Matsui DVDR100

Hi,

I've got the above DVD recorder and have had it about 18mths. It doesn't get much use either for recording or playing and everytime I want to record something, I need to refer to the manual (6yr old kids live with their mum LOL). Very Happy

Anyway, like I said, it doesn't get used much and suddenly its just died on me! At first I noticed the time was static and had been for a couple of days. I couldn't re-set the time via the remote control and couldn't switch the player off with the remote or at on the player, so I pulled the plug from the wall. Now the player doesn't show any lights and seems dead. I've done all the usual things like check the power socket and changed the fuse. It just seems very odd that its just died.

Can anyone shed any light on my problem? Confused
